LAWRENCEVILLE -- If you're looking for a furry, four-legged stocking stuffer this holiday season, the Gwinnett Animal Shelter has an event for you.
Through Dec. 23, each animal can be adopted for a $30 spay/neuter fee, and the shelter hopes to reach its goal that every animal in the shelter would be adopted by Christmas.
The shelter will also have a pictures and cookies with Santa event from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. on Dec. 15. Eight by 10 inch photos are available for $10 and CDs are available for $5.
The Gwinnett Animal Welfare and Enforcement Center is located at 884 Winder Highway in Lawrenceville. For more information, or to make an appointment for a picture, call 770-339-3200.
